International cruise ship Adora Mediterranea starts cruise season in north China’s port city Tianjin

TIANJIN, China, June 11, 2025 /Xinhua-AsiaNet/–

On June 8, the “Ship of Art” Adora Mediterranea set sail with nearly 2,600 passengers, launching an international cruise route to Japan and South Korea, marking the official start of the 2025 cruise season in Tianjin, according to the Tianjin Dongjiang bonded area.

 

Recently, Adora Mediterranea, owned by Adora Cruises, returned to the Tianjin International Cruise Home Port located in the port city’s Dongjiang bonded area. It will operate from Tianjin and offer more than ten 6-day, 5-night international cruise itineraries. Meanwhile, on August 7, the ship will launch a 12-day, 11-night long summer cruise to Hokkaido.

 

During the launch ceremony of the cruise season, Adora Cruises announced its deployment plan for the Tianjin route for 2026-2027. According to the plan, from June to October 2026, Adora Mediterranea will operate 24 international cruise voyages to Japan and South Korea from Tianjin as the home port.

 

In 2027, Adora Cruises will increase its investment, with plans to launch the first domestically produced large cruise ship, Adora Magic City, in Tianjin from April to October for a six-month sailing season.

 

Additionally, Adora Mediterranea is set to commence its winter season in Tianjin from January to March 2027. Together, Adora Magic City and Adora Mediterranea are expected to operate over 50 voyages in Tianjin throughout the year.

 

As a flagship enterprise in China’s cruise industry, Adora Cruises has been actively engaging in the domestic market, with its two large ships — Adora Magic City and Adora Mediterranea — having collectively hosted nearly 700,000 domestic and international travelers.
